Why Choose a Treadmill for Home?
Treadmills supply a hassle-free method to exercise indoors, despite the weather condition. They permit personalized exercises, allowing users to adjust speed and incline, making them ideal for interval training or steady-state cardio. Furthermore, many modern treadmills come geared up with sophisticated functions like integrated home entertainment systems, heart rate displays, and various exercise programs, contributing to their appeal.
Key Features to Consider
When selecting a treadmill brands, keep these vital functions in mind:
- Motor Power: Look for a motor with a minimum of 2.5 HP for a smooth running experience, specifically if you intend to run frequently.
- Running Surface: A larger and longer belt offers better freedom of motion. Goal for at least 50 cm in width and 140 cm in length for a comfortable experience.
- Incline Options: An adjustable incline can add range to your workouts and increase difficulty effectively.
- Foldability: If area is an issue, consider a folding treadmill that can be quickly saved when not in use.
- Weight Capacity: Verify the optimum weight capacity of the treadmill to guarantee it can accommodate all users.
- Service warranty: A strong service warranty can be a great indication of develop quality and sturdiness.

FAQs about Home Treadmills
Q1: Are treadmills worth the financial investment for home usage?A1: Yes, if you are committed to exercising routinely, a treadmill can supply a constant exercise no matter external conditions.
Q2: How much do treadmills typically cost in the UK?A2: Prices differ widely from about ₤ 300 for fundamental designs to over ₤ 1,000 for sophisticated choices with more features.
Q3: How much area do I need for a treadmill?A3: Most treadmills require at least 2 meters of height clearance and a space of around 2 meters in length and 1 meter in width.
Q4: How often should I oil my treadmill?A4: It is recommended to lube your treadmill’s belt every 3-6 months, depending upon usage.
Q5: Can I utilize a treadmill if I have joint issues?A5: Treadmills equipped with good cushioning can be useful for those with joint concerns. However, it’s advised to seek advice from a healthcare professional before starting any physical fitness regimen.
